West Virginia Troopers Cite 23 During US 60 Crackdown
West Virginia State Police troopers cited 23 drivers during a crackdown on speeding and texting on U.S. 60 in Culloden.
Sgt. Greg Losh tells The Herald-Dispatch that troopers also issued 67 warnings during Tuesday’s saturation patrol.
He says four people were found to be driving on suspended licenses. Troopers discovered a small amount of marijuana and heroin during one traffic stop.
Complaints about speeding and texting drivers prompted the saturation patrol.
